ARP Requests Sometimes Fail for Access Points Connected Directly to 
2100 Series Controllers
Cisco 2100 series controllers do not support ARP requests from access points connected directly to a 
port on the controller unless there is an interface configured on that controller port. ARP requests from 
the access point cannot reach the gateway on the interface VLAN and the access point might lose its 
connection to the controller.
To work around this limitation, configure the access point’s default gateway to match the controller’s 
management IP address, or connect the access point to a switch port between the access point and the 
2100 series controller.
WPlus License Features Included in Base License
All features included in a Wireless LAN Controller WPlus license are now included in the base license; 
this change is introduced in release 6.0.196.0. There are no changes to WCS BASE and PLUS licensing. 
These WPlus license features are included in the base license:
Office Extend AP
Enterprise Mesh
CAPWAP Data Encryption
The licensing change can affect features on your wireless LAN when you upgrade or downgrade 
software releases, so you should be aware of these guidelines:
If you have a WPlus license and you upgrade from 6.0.18x to 6.0.196.0: Your license file contains 
both Basic and WPlus license features. You won’t see any disruption in feature availability and 
operation.
If you have a WPlus license and you downgrade from 6.0.196.0 to 6.0.188 or 6.0.182: The license 
file in 6.0.196.0 contains both Basic and WPlus license features, so you won’t see any disruption in 
feature availability and operation.
If you have a base license and you downgrade from 6.0.196.0 to 6.0.188 or 6.0.182: When you 
downgrade, you lose all WPlus features. 
Note
Some references to Wireless LAN Controller WPlus licenses remain in WCS and in the controller CLI 
and GUI in release 6.0.196.0. However, WLC WPlus license features have been included in the Base 
license, so you can ignore those references.
Additive Licenses Available for 5500 Series Controllers
You can now purchase licenses to support additional access points on 5500 series controllers. The new 
additive licenses (for 25, 50, or 100 access points) can be upgraded from all license tiers (12, 25, 50, 100, 
and 250 access points). The additive licenses are supported through both rehosting and RMAs.
